Headscarf: A Sheer Refinement84


In the realm of fashion, the headscarf stands as a versatile and timeless accessory, capable of elevating any ensemble with its ethereal elegance. Its origins can be traced back to ancient civilizations, where it served both functional and decorative purposes. Today, the headscarf continues to captivate hearts with its ability to add a touch of glamour, sophistication, and effortless chic to any outfit.

When crafted from sheer fabrics, the headscarf takes on an almost ethereal quality. Its translucent nature allows for subtle glimpses of the wearer's hair or skin, creating an alluring interplay of textures and depths. This delicate transparency adds an air of femininity and grace, making it a perfect complement to soft summer dresses and flowing skirts.

The versatility of the sheer headscarf knows no bounds. It can be effortlessly styled in various ways, from classic head wraps to chic turbans. Whether knotted at the back or wrapped around the neck like a delicate scarf, it instantly transforms any look from ordinary to extraordinary. Its lightweight and breathable nature makes it a comfortable choice for both warm and cool seasons.

One of the most captivating aspects of the sheer headscarf is its ability to enhance facial features. When draped over the head, it can create a flattering frame for the face, drawing attention to the eyes and cheekbones. Its soft and flowing fabric adds a touch of softness to the complexion, making it an ideal choice for special occasions or nights out on the town.

In addition to its aesthetic appeal, the sheer headscarf also offers practical benefits. It can protect delicate hair from sun damage, wind, or rain, while also keeping the head cool and comfortable. Its versatility extends to the realm of skincare, as it can be used as a headband to keep hair away from the face during a skincare routine or as a sleep cap to protect hair from tangling.

When selecting a sheer headscarf, there are several factors to consider. Size is an important aspect, as it will determine the coverage and styling options available. The fabric's texture and drape can also impact the overall look and feel of the headscarf. Silk, chiffon, and organza are popular choices for their luxurious hand and delicate appearance.

Color plays a pivotal role in the impact of a sheer headscarf. Solid colors offer a timeless and versatile option, while patterned headscarves can add a touch of vibrancy and personality to an outfit. From bold prints to delicate florals, the choice of pattern is endless.
